## Account Recovery — Flagpath Rollout Framework

Plugin authors locked out of the Flagpath sandbox: do not re-register. Open a recovery request, confirm your plugin slug, wait for the automated challenge. One attempt per hour. Abuse suspends the account. After the challenge clears, the console prompts for your recovery passphrase; enter the one printed below.

recovery phrase for bawep-kawef: oliath-casdor

- [ ] Pool car key cabinet — day one

If you'll ever need a pool car, swing by the Thornly Depot back office and find the grey key cabinet by the noticeboard. Sign the logbook every time you take or return a set of keys — no exceptions, or Fleet will chase you. The cabinet has a push-button lock, and the current code is below.

door code, kawip-bagap: bdg-HQEWH-4

Q: Where do crash reports from the Lumenote mobile app actually go? A: Reports are batched on-device, uploaded over the telemetry channel, deduplicated by stack fingerprint, and then routed into the Sievewell triage queue. Note that symbolication depends on build artifacts being retained for 90 days; if symbols are missing, reports arrive unreadable. Full pipeline diagrams and retention settings are maintained on the internal page below.

operations page: https://vault.qirvanhq.local/ticket